Obituary of William John Scott

On Saturday, April 24th, William John Scott, dedicated and loving husband & father of four, passed away from an unexpected health condition at the age of 53. He was with family and at the place he loved most; Camp Bonaparte. Bill was born on October 15th, 1967 in Syracuse, New York, a community he served endlessly.

He was a licensed master social worker, elected as the President of the Syracuse Teachers Association in May of 2019. He was employed with Syracuse City School District since 2006. Social justice and advocacy were lifelong passions.

Bill is survived by his wife of almost 20 years, Carolyn Esther Scott (Lavine) and his 4 children, Megan Elizabeth, Amelia Vera, Aiden Cary, and Liam Reese. His parents, William Henry Scott and Carolyn Margaret Scott, his sister Dawn Topolewski (Bryan Topolewski) and his 2 nieces. As well as his uncles, aunts, and 15 first cousins and their children. Through marriage he gained 3 loving brothers; Michael, Jerry (Faith), and Scott Lavine. He was a loving uncle to 6 Lavine nieces and nephews. Bill is additionally survived by his father-in-law Robert Lavine (Bob) and predeceased by his mother-in-law Martha Lavine.

Bill had a passion for cars and racing like no other. A fanatic of comics, “Calvin and Hobbes,” Star Wars, James Bond, U2, DMB, thorough pranks and Halloween decorations. He loved to work on handyman projects and home remodeling with his wife - many to still be finished! He was known for being a proud father and change maker of the community. We will miss him forever.
